The Historical Roots of Kite Flying

The origins of kite flying are shrouded in antiquity, with evidence suggesting its practice dates back over two millennia. While the precise birthplace remains debated, many historians attribute its development to ancient China, where kites were initially used for military purposes. These early kites were not the delicate, decorative creations we often see today; instead, they were employed for signaling, measuring distances, and even testing wind conditions. Gradually, the practice transitioned from utilitarian applications to recreational pursuits, becoming a popular pastime among the imperial court and eventually spreading to other parts of Asia.

The Silk Road played a pivotal role in disseminating the art of kite flying westward. As trade routes flourished, so too did the exchange of culture and technology. By the medieval period, kites had reached the Middle East and Europe, where they were adapted and modified to suit local aesthetics and preferences. Early European kites were often large and elaborate, constructed from fabric and wood. They were used for similar purposes as their Chinese counterparts, including military signaling and, to a lesser extent, recreation. The evolution of kite design continued throughout the centuries, leading to the development of various regional styles and techniques.

The Spread to the Indian Subcontinent

The arrival of kite flying in the Indian subcontinent is believed to have occurred through cultural exchange with Persia and Central Asia. The Mughal Empire, in particular, embraced kite flying as a royal pastime, and it quickly gained popularity amongst the nobility. Over time, the practice became deeply integrated into local customs, evolving into the vibrant tradition we know today. The kites used in the Indian subcontinent often feature unique designs and materials, reflecting the diverse cultural influences of the region. The competitive aspect of kite flying, often involving the use of abrasive strings to cut the strings of opposing kites, also became a prominent feature of the practice.

Kite flying traditions in India are particularly strong, with specific festivals dedicated to the practice. The International Kite Festival in Gujarat is a prime example, attracting kite enthusiasts from around the world. These festivals showcase the artistry and skill involved in kite making and flying, and serve as a testament to the enduring appeal of this ancient pastime.

The Art of Kite Construction

Creating a functional and aesthetically pleasing kite requires a blend of craftsmanship and understanding of aerodynamic principles. The materials used in kite construction have evolved over time, ranging from traditional materials like bamboo, paper, and silk to modern synthetics like ripstop nylon and carbon fiber. The choice of materials significantly impacts the kite's weight, strength, and flight characteristics. A well-constructed kite must be lightweight enough to be lifted by the wind, yet durable enough to withstand the stresses of flight and potential collisions.

The frame of a kite provides structural support and determines its shape. Traditional kites often utilize a bamboo framework, meticulously bent and bound together to create a strong and flexible structure. Modern kites frequently employ carbon fiber or fiberglass spars, which offer greater strength-to-weight ratios. The kite’s sail, the surface that catches the wind, is typically made from paper, silk, or synthetic fabrics. The sail’s surface area and shape influence the kite’s lift and stability.

The Importance of the Bridle

The bridle is a crucial component of a kite, connecting the flying line to the kite’s frame. Its proper adjustment is essential for achieving optimal flight performance. The bridle’s angle determines the angle of attack, which affects the amount of lift generated by the kite. A poorly adjusted bridle can result in a kite that is unstable, difficult to control, or unable to fly at all. Experienced kite makers and flyers often spend considerable time fine-tuning the bridle to achieve the desired flight characteristics. The bridle’s design also contributes to the kite’s responsiveness to wind changes and the flyer's control inputs.

The placement of the bridle attachment points affects how the kite responds to the wind. Altering the bridle’s configuration can change the kite’s stability, turning radius, and overall flight behavior. Understanding the principles of bridle adjustment is a key skill for anyone seeking to master the art of kite flying.

Maintaining a properly adjusted bridle is essential for safe and enjoyable kite flying. Regular inspections and minor adjustments can prevent potential problems and maximize the kite’s performance.

Competitive Kite Flying: Patang-Bazi

In many cultures, kite flying extends beyond recreational enjoyment to encompass a competitive aspect. This is particularly prominent in the Indian subcontinent, where the practice of “patang-bazi,” or kite fighting, is a beloved tradition. Patang-bazi involves flying kites with abrasive strings, often coated with powdered glass, with the goal of cutting the strings of opposing kites. The kite whose string is cut is considered defeated, and the winner is often rewarded with the fallen kite.

The techniques employed in patang-bazi require skill, precision, and a deep understanding of wind conditions. Kite flyers must skillfully maneuver their kites to position themselves for an attack, while simultaneously defending against attempts to cut their own string. The use of specialized strings and kite designs is crucial for success in patang-bazi. Modern innovations in string technology have led to the development of highly abrasive strings that can cut through even the strongest opponents’ lines.

Safety Considerations in Competitive Kite Flying

While patang-bazi is a thrilling and engaging activity, it also carries inherent risks. The use of abrasive strings can pose a danger to bystanders, as well as to the kite flyers themselves. It is essential to practice safety precautions, such as wearing gloves and eye protection, and avoiding flying kites near power lines or crowded areas. Responsible kite flying requires respect for the safety of others and adherence to local regulations.

Additionally, the competitive nature of patang-bazi can sometimes lead to reckless behavior. Encouraging responsible competition and promoting a culture of safety are crucial for ensuring that this tradition remains enjoyable and sustainable for future generations. The focus should be on skill and strategy, rather than on aggressive tactics that prioritize winning at all costs.

  1. Always wear gloves to protect your hands from cuts.
  2. Wear sunglasses or other eye protection to shield your eyes from abrasive strings.
  3. Avoid flying kites near power lines or roads.
  4. Be aware of your surroundings and avoid flying kites near other people.
  5. Respect local regulations and guidelines for kite flying.

Following these safety guidelines is important to ensure a safe and enjoyable experience for everyone involved in kite flying.

The Cultural Significance of Patang

The enduring appeal of the patang transcends mere recreation; it is deeply intertwined with cultural identity and social bonding. The act of flying a kite is often associated with celebrations, festivals, and seasonal changes, serving as a symbol of renewal and hope. In many communities, kite flying is a communal activity, bringing people together to share in a collective experience. The vibrant colors and intricate designs of kites reflect the artistic traditions and cultural values of the regions where they are flown.

Moreover, the patang often serves as a vehicle for storytelling and the transmission of cultural knowledge. The designs and motifs adorning kites can depict historical events, mythological figures, or local folklore, preserving and celebrating cultural heritage. The practice of kite flying also fosters a sense of intergenerational connection, with elders passing down their skills and knowledge to younger generations.
